BOOK SYNOPSIS
Going to the job site with Dad
When darkness falls and bedtime comes, Papa tucks Alex in, then puts on his hard hat and goes to work. Papa is an engineer who works at night. "Take me with you," Alex says. "Not tonight," says Papa. But one night Papa has a surprise -- a hard hat for Alex! He takes Alex with him to the construction site, where excavators rumble and cement mixers hum. As his dream comes true, Alex gets to be a night worker just like Papa. Kate Banks's evocative text and Georg Hallensleben's colorful paintings combine to make a unique bedtime book that will delight all children, especially those who are fascinated by big machines.
BOOK REVIEWS
"[A] sublime evening story . . . Banks' elegant, simple words and poetic images and rhythms evoke the book's exciting activity . . . Hallensleben's paintings extend the story's balance of exhilarating intensity and reassuring calm . . . A lovely, affecting portrait of a father and son and of the night world." -Starred, Booklist
The pictured warmth of the father-son relationship combines with restrained yet poetic text to make this take your son to work night a special one indeed. --Kirkus Reviews
A mesmerizing description of a busy nighttime realm, illuminated by blazing headlights and framed by silent skyscrapers. --Starred, Publishers Weekly
